Japanese automakers to invest $4.3 billion over 5 years in Thailand
BANGKOK, Thailand: This week, Chai Wacharoke, spokesperson for the Thai government, said that to support the Southeast Asian country's transition to producing electric vehicles (EV), major Japanese auto manufacturers will invest 150 billion baht (US$4.34 billion) in Thailand over the next five years.
